CVE-2023-44401 Detail

Description

The Silverstripe CMS GraphQL Server serves Silverstripe data as GraphQL representations. In versions 4.0.0 prior to 4.3.7 and 5.0.0 prior to 5.1.3, `canView` permission checks are bypassed for ORM data in paginated GraphQL query results where the total number of records is greater than the number of records per page. Note that this also affects GraphQL queries which have a limit applied, even if the query isn’t paginated per se. This has been fixed in versions 4.3.7 and 5.1.3 by ensuring no new records are pulled in from the database after performing `canView` permission checks for each page of results. This may result in some pages in the query results having less than the maximum number of records per page even when there are more pages of results. This behavior is consistent with how pagination works in other areas of Silverstripe CMS, such as in `GridField`, and is a result of having to perform permission checks in PHP rather than in the database directly. One may disable these permission checks by disabling the `CanViewPermission` plugin.
